What is an Icing Sugar Grinding Machine?

  • Integration of mill and classifier,it is free from over grinding.
  • Sharp particle size distribution,fineness 60-380 mesh is adjustable.
  • Inner temperature is reduced by airflow,and grinding chamber is used water cooling jacket for cooling, which is suitable for heat-sensitive materials.
  • Negative operation is free of dust pollution.
  • Compact structure.
  • A little wearing parts and easy maintenance.

Air Classifying Mill 5

Figure 1 – A sample of what an icing sugar grinding machine looks like

It’s a type of machine that grinds and pulverizes sugar in order to produce finer and smaller particles or icing sugar.

In case you’re not aware, icing sugar is a type of finely powdered sugar that’s about 10 times smaller and finer than regular sugar. It’s finely ground and you can create and produce it through the process of milling.

Don’t be confused, sugar grinding machines aren’t necessarily a part of the sugar milling process. Instead, it’s an additive machine or equipment that’s used to process finer particles of sugar, salt, and other materials that are dry.

How Fine Can an Icing Sugar Grinding Machine Grind?

icing sugar grinding machine

Figure 3 – Sample of how fine an icing sugar grinding machine can produce

Different icing sugar grinding machines can yield different results. Therefore, it’s imperative that you know the specifications of the icing sugar grinder machine you are about to buy and purchase.

The measurement of the fineness of icing sugar is in mesh, and usually, icing sugar grinding machines that are average can produce 50 to 200 mesh. Good-quality icing sugar grinding machines, on the other hand, can produce mesh sizes that are within the 300 to 350 mesh size.

Parts of an Icing Sugar Grinding Machine

icing sugar grinding machine (1)

Figure 4 – Parts and components of an icing sugar grinder

While there are a lot of icing sugar grinding machines that already have different parts and components, we’ll present to you the parts and the components considered as the standard of icing sugar grinding machines.

Hopper or Feed Inlet

This is the component that starts the process; it’s where the particles and the materials are fed to be operated and to be worked on.

Crushing Chamber

Also known and referred to as the working chamber, it’s the component where the powders and the materials are ground down and worked on.

Door or Window

The door, hinge, or the observatory window is the component that allows you to get a peek of what’s happening. It’s where you can try and assess the consistency of the material being worked on.

Mesh Screen

The mesh screen is the component that filters the powders to check if they’re already at the requires size before they flow down to the discharge or the outlet ports.  

Motor

The motor is the component that makes the grinding activity work. Without the motor, the grinding action would not happen.

Cooling Component

The cooling part or component in an icing sugar grinding machine is responsible for making the particles or the materials moist. Since they’re ground, friction is produced and it can cause a fire. So, with a cooling component, fires are avoided.

Discharge Port

Lastly, the discharge port is the part in the machine where all the finished products flow. It’s the exit point of the machines (entry point is hopper).

Is an Industrial Sugar Grinder the Same as a Fine Mesh Grinder?

A lot of people get confused when they encounter either of the terms.

When, in reality, they’re almost completely alike – the only difference would be the output or the substances produced.

In a fine mesh grinder, the mesh size of the products are a lot smoother, thinner, smaller, and have more finesse.

With a regular industrial sugar grinder, on the other hand, you wouldn’t be able to produce finely granulated substances, unless of course, your machine is tagged as superfine or ultra-fine industrial grinder.

To sum it all up, an industrial sugar grinder and a fine mesh grinder can either be two (2) different things or two (2) same things – it will just depend on the type mesh size of products you want to achieve.

What’s the Regular Mesh Size of Industrial Sugar Grinders?

The most common and most typical mesh size of the output of these industrial sugar grinders would be about 60 to 120 mesh.

Industrial Sugar Grinders

An image of a fine mesh powder as a product of an industrial sugar grinder (ultra or superfine)

There are those, however, that can go as high as 150 depending on the number of blades, the feature or the functionality of the machine, as well as the speed that the motor can bear during the grinding procedure.

What Are the Usual Materials Used to Create Sugar Grinder Pulverizers?

Sugar Grinder Pulverizer 3

Stainless steels – one of the most common materials used in producing sugar grinder pulverizers

Various sugar grinder pulverizer manufacturers utilize different types and kinds of raw materials for the production of their machines.

However, the most common and the most usual materials you’ll encounter for sugar grinder pulverizers would be high-carbon alloy steels, aluminum steels, as well as stainless steels.

The reason why these are the materials needed is because of the fact that the machines need to be resistant to the usual and the traditional wear and tear process, which includes corrosion, abrasion, as well as adhesion.

Among these raw materials, though, stainless steel is the most common because it’s the most resistant to corrosion as well as scratches. All the while maintaining its lightweight and easy-to-carry functionality.

How Does a Sugar Grinder Pulverizer Work?

Sugar grinder pulverizers work the same way how regular grinding milling machines do – they crush, pulverize, and grind substances and materials so that they become smaller, finer, and smoother.

Here’s the process on how sugar grinder pulverizers work:

  1. The material or the substance is fed through the hopper or the feed inlet.
  2. Depending on the type of sugar grinder pulverizer, the worker will open the passageway from the inlet to the crushing or the grinding chamber.
  3. As the motor spins, the crushing material functions. All the substances and materials that go through it will be crushed and pulverized.
  4. The powdered granules that are already in the right size are deposited to a door or an outlet where it wouldn’t pass through the grinding and the pulverizing chambers any longer.
  5. Then, when the process is done and finished, all processed granules come out of the discharge part or the discharge port.

That’s the general structure of how sugar grinder pulverizing machines work and function.

What Are the Parts of a Sugar Grinder Pulverizer?

Since not all sugar grinder pulverizers look and work the same way, there might be subtle differences with the overall structure of the machine.

For this part, we’ll give you the parts that are imperative. Should a sugar grinder pulverizer not have any of these, it would not be able to work and function appropriately.

Feed Inlet or Hopper

This is the part or the component of a sugar grinder pulverizer where the substances or the materials are fed.

It’s the entryway of the machine going to the chamber.

Screen or Flow Control

While you can construct and build sugar grinder pulverizers even without a screen, it’s still a relevant component because it controls the flow or the downpour of the substances down the crushing room or crushing chamber.

Units that do not have a flow control or a screen would usually just have a small hole so that the flow of the substances is slow.

Crushing Chamber

This is the part or the component where the magic of sugar grinder pulverizers happen.

It’s the component equipped with the blades that are responsible for the size reduction of the powders and the granulated substances that need to be processed.

Water-Cooling

The water-cooling component you’ll find in sugar grinder pulverizers mediate the build up of heat in the cutting zone or area.

What this does is it eliminates the heat that’s produced by the machine, which alters the temperature of the substances or the materials.

Motor

The motor is what makes the crushing chamber work and function. Without a motor, then there would be no source of power for the sugar grinder pulverizer to take effect.

Outlets

The outlets are the holes in which the materials come out. If there’s a feed inlet, then there’s an outlet.

Several outlets are present in a sugar grinder pulverizer because if a particular granule is already at the recommended size, it exits out of the machine without being grinded and pulverized.

These are the most relevant and the most important parts of sugar grinder pulverizing machines. And, as we’ve mentioned , some manufacturers might have changed or altered some of the components for added features of their equipment.
